What Does a Legal Nurse Do?

In the course of their work, a consultant may be involved in any of the following:
  • Maintain the confidentiality of your practice
  • Conduct client interviews
  • Identify standards of care, causation, and damage issues
  • Conduct research and summarize literature
  • Help to determine the merits of the case
  • Prepare chronologies of medical events and compare and correlate them to allegations
  • Educate attorneys regarding medical facts and issues relevant to the case
  • Assist with depositions and preparing exhibits
  • Organize medical records and other medically related litigation materials
  • Identify and retain expert witnesses

Where Does a Consultant Practice?
An associate can practice in a variety of law-related and healthcare settings and can work for both plaintiff and defense capacities in any of these areas:
  • Law firms
  • Independent practice
  • Insurance Companies
  • Government offices
  • Hospital risk management departments
